Changeset 4462

Show
Ignore:
Timestamp:
01/31/07 17:34:40 (2 years ago)
Author:
morris
Message:

Also redirect paste to insertion text view in chat windows

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• WiredClient/trunk/English.lproj/PrivateChat.nib/classes.nib

    r4169 r4462  
    5050            SUPERCLASS = WCConnectionController;  
    5151        },  
     52        {CLASS = WCChatTextView; LANGUAGE = ObjC; SUPERCLASS = WITextView; },  
    5253        {CLASS = WCChatWindow; LANGUAGE = ObjC; SUPERCLASS = WIWindow; },  
    5354        { 
  • WiredClient/trunk/English.lproj/PrivateChat.nib/info.nib

    r4169 r4462  
    2424        </array> 
    2525        <key>IBSystem Version</key> 
    26         <string>8I127</string> 
     26        <string>8L127</string> 
    2727</dict> 
    2828</plist> 
  • WiredClient/trunk/English.lproj/PublicChat.nib/classes.nib

    r4169 r4462  
    5050            SUPERCLASS = WCConnectionController;  
    5151        },  
     52        {CLASS = WCChatTextView; LANGUAGE = ObjC; SUPERCLASS = WITextView; },  
    5253        {CLASS = WCChatWindow; LANGUAGE = ObjC; SUPERCLASS = WIWindow; },  
    5354        { 
  • WiredClient/trunk/English.lproj/PublicChat.nib/info.nib

    r4455 r4462  
    44<dict> 
    55        <key>IBDocumentLocation</key> 
    6         <string>49 394 408 436 0 0 1280 1002 </string> 
     6        <string>439 531 408 436 0 0 1920 1178 </string> 
    77        <key>IBEditorPositions</key> 
    88        <dict> 
  • WiredClient/trunk/French.lproj/PrivateChat.nib/classes.nib

    r4169 r4462  
    5050            SUPERCLASS = WCConnectionController;  
    5151        },  
     52        {CLASS = WCChatTextView; LANGUAGE = ObjC; SUPERCLASS = WITextView; },  
    5253        {CLASS = WCChatWindow; LANGUAGE = ObjC; SUPERCLASS = WIWindow; },  
    5354        { 
  • WiredClient/trunk/French.lproj/PrivateChat.nib/info.nib

    r4169 r4462  
    2424        </array> 
    2525        <key>IBSystem Version</key> 
    26         <string>8I127</string> 
     26        <string>8L127</string> 
    2727</dict> 
    2828</plist> 
  • WiredClient/trunk/French.lproj/PublicChat.nib/classes.nib

    r4147 r4462  
    4646            SUPERCLASS = WCConnectionController;  
    4747        },  
     48        {CLASS = WCChatTextView; LANGUAGE = ObjC; SUPERCLASS = WITextView; },  
    4849        {CLASS = WCChatWindow; LANGUAGE = ObjC; SUPERCLASS = WIWindow; },  
    4950        { 
  • WiredClient/trunk/French.lproj/PublicChat.nib/info.nib

    r4147 r4462  
    2323        </array> 
    2424        <key>IBSystem Version</key> 
    25         <string>8I127</string> 
     25        <string>8L127</string> 
    2626</dict> 
    2727</plist> 
  • WiredClient/trunk/German.lproj/PrivateChat.nib/classes.nib

    r4237 r4462  
    5050            SUPERCLASS = WCConnectionController;  
    5151        },  
     52        {CLASS = WCChatTextView; LANGUAGE = ObjC; SUPERCLASS = WITextView; },  
    5253        {CLASS = WCChatWindow; LANGUAGE = ObjC; SUPERCLASS = WIWindow; },  
    5354        { 
  • WiredClient/trunk/German.lproj/PrivateChat.nib/info.nib

    r4237 r4462  
    2424        </array> 
    2525        <key>IBSystem Version</key> 
    26         <string>8I127</string> 
     26        <string>8L127</string> 
    2727</dict> 
    2828</plist> 
  • WiredClient/trunk/German.lproj/PublicChat.nib/classes.nib

    r4237 r4462  
    5050            SUPERCLASS = WCConnectionController;  
    5151        },  
     52        {CLASS = WCChatTextView; LANGUAGE = ObjC; SUPERCLASS = WITextView; },  
    5253        {CLASS = WCChatWindow; LANGUAGE = ObjC; SUPERCLASS = WIWindow; },  
    5354        { 
  • WiredClient/trunk/German.lproj/PublicChat.nib/info.nib

    r4237 r4462  
    88        <dict> 
    99                <key>105</key> 
    10                 <string>542 663 218 187 0 0 1280 1002 </string> 
     10                <string>869 806 218 187 0 0 1920 1178 </string> 
    1111        </dict> 
    1212        <key>IBFramework Version</key> 
     
    2020        <key>IBOpenObjects</key> 
    2121        <array> 
     22                <integer>105</integer> 
    2223                <integer>10</integer> 
    23                 <integer>105</integer> 
    2424        </array> 
    2525        <key>IBSystem Version</key> 
    26         <string>8I127</string> 
     26        <string>8L127</string> 
    2727</dict> 
    2828</plist> 
  • WiredClient/trunk/Japanese.lproj/PrivateChat.nib/classes.nib

    r4169 r4462  
    5050            SUPERCLASS = WCConnectionController;  
    5151        },  
     52        {CLASS = WCChatTextView; LANGUAGE = ObjC; SUPERCLASS = WITextView; },  
    5253        {CLASS = WCChatWindow; LANGUAGE = ObjC; SUPERCLASS = WIWindow; },  
    5354        { 
  • WiredClient/trunk/Japanese.lproj/PrivateChat.nib/info.nib

    r4169 r4462  
    2020        <key>IBOpenObjects</key> 
    2121        <array> 
     22                <integer>139</integer> 
    2223                <integer>250</integer> 
    23                 <integer>139</integer> 
    2424        </array> 
    2525        <key>IBSystem Version</key> 
    26         <string>8I127</string> 
     26        <string>8L127</string> 
    2727</dict> 
    2828</plist> 
  • WiredClient/trunk/Japanese.lproj/PublicChat.nib/classes.nib

    r4143 r4462  
    4646            SUPERCLASS = WCConnectionController;  
    4747        },  
     48        {CLASS = WCChatTextView; LANGUAGE = ObjC; SUPERCLASS = WITextView; },  
    4849        {CLASS = WCChatWindow; LANGUAGE = ObjC; SUPERCLASS = WIWindow; },  
    4950        { 
  • WiredClient/trunk/Japanese.lproj/PublicChat.nib/info.nib

    r4146 r4462  
    1818        <key>IBOldestOS</key> 
    1919        <integer>3</integer> 
     20        <key>IBOpenObjects</key> 
     21        <array> 
     22                <integer>10</integer> 
     23        </array> 
    2024        <key>IBSystem Version</key> 
    21         <string>8I127</string> 
     25        <string>8L127</string> 
    2226</dict> 
    2327</plist> 
  • WiredClient/trunk/WCChatWindow.m

    r4439 r4462  
    5757} 
    5858 
     59 
     60 
     61- (void)paste:(id)sender { 
     62        NSTextView              *textView; 
     63 
     64        textView = [[self delegate] insertionTextView]; 
     65         
     66        [self makeFirstResponder:textView]; 
     67        [textView paste:sender]; 
     68} 
     69 
    5970@end 
  • WiredClient/trunk/WiredClient.xcodeproj/project.pbxproj

    r4457 r4462  
    7373                77B5F96F097FDD3B00C055E1 /* NSAlert-WCAdditions.m in Sources */ = {isa = PBXBuildFile; fileRef = 77B5F96D097FDD3B00C055E1 /* NSAlert-WCAdditions.m */; }; 
    7474                77B5F973097FDD4500C055E1 /* NSString-WCAdditions.m in Sources */ = {isa = PBXBuildFile; fileRef = 77B5F971097FDD4500C055E1 /* NSString-WCAdditions.m */; }; 
     75                77C83C340B70FBD8000F8478 /* WCChatTextView.m in Sources */ = {isa = PBXBuildFile; fileRef = 77C83C320B70FBD8000F8478 /* WCChatTextView.m */; }; 
    7576                77D29ECD0A2DB77800173F3C /* WCFilesController.m in Sources */ = {isa = PBXBuildFile; fileRef = 77D29ECB0A2DB77800173F3C /* WCFilesController.m */; }; 
    7677                77E170E90980F3120044D290 /* NSNotificationCenter-WCAdditions.m in Sources */ = {isa = PBXBuildFile; fileRef = 77E170E70980F3120044D290 /* NSNotificationCenter-WCAdditions.m */; }; 
     
    323324                77B5F970097FDD4500C055E1 /* NSString-WCAdditions.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; path = "NSString-WCAdditions.h"; sourceTree = "<group>"; }; 
    324325                77B5F971097FDD4500C055E1 /* NSString-WCAdditions.m */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.objc; path = "NSString-WCAdditions.m"; sourceTree = "<group>"; }; 
     326                77C83C310B70FBD8000F8478 /* WCChatTextView.h */ = {isa = PBXFileReference; fileEncoding = 5; lastKnownFileType = sourcecode.c.h; path = WCChatTextView.h; sourceTree = "<group>"; }; 
     327                77C83C320B70FBD8000F8478 /* WCChatTextView.m */ = {isa = PBXFileReference; fileEncoding = 5; lastKnownFileType = sourcecode.c.objc; path = WCChatTextView.m; sourceTree = "<group>"; }; 
    325328                77D29ECA0A2DB77800173F3C /* WCFilesController.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; path = WCFilesController.h; sourceTree = "<group>"; }; 
    326329                77D29ECB0A2DB77800173F3C /* WCFilesController.m */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.objc; path = WCFilesController.m; sourceTree = "<group>"; }; 
     
    751754                                A5DC7F1F057AAFE100736BBF /* WCChat.m */, 
    752755                                A5DC7F24057AAFE100736BBF /* WCChat.h */, 
     756                                77C83C320B70FBD8000F8478 /* WCChatTextView.m */, 
     757                                77C83C310B70FBD8000F8478 /* WCChatTextView.h */, 
    753758                                777D3F6509890273005B5EC1 /* WCChatWindow.m */, 
    754759                                777D3F6709890278005B5EC1 /* WCChatWindow.h */, 
     
    14601465                                A57512EC05E4E64D003B51D7 /* WCCache.m in Sources */, 
    14611466                                A5DC7F25057AAFE100736BBF /* WCChat.m in Sources */, 
     1467                                77C83C340B70FBD8000F8478 /* WCChatTextView.m in Sources */, 
    14621468                                777D3F6609890273005B5EC1 /* WCChatWindow.m in Sources */, 
    14631469                                A5A338FE0720483C00A16E9A /* WCConnectionController.m in Sources */,